## What is the Architecture of Decentralized Regulatory Compliance?

⎊ Decentralized Regulatory Compliance within cryptocurrency, options, and derivatives relies on a system architecture shifting from centralized intermediaries to distributed ledger technology. This transition necessitates the integration of smart contracts to automate compliance processes, reducing operational risk and enhancing transparency. The underlying framework leverages cryptographic protocols to ensure data integrity and immutability, vital for auditability and regulatory reporting. Consequently, this architecture aims to establish a verifiable and auditable trail of transactions, aligning with evolving regulatory expectations for digital asset markets.

## What is the Compliance of Decentralized Regulatory Compliance?

⎊ Decentralized Regulatory Compliance represents a paradigm shift in how financial regulations are enforced, moving away from reliance on central authorities to a system of self-execution through code. It involves embedding regulatory requirements directly into the protocols governing cryptocurrency transactions and derivative contracts, ensuring adherence without traditional intermediaries. This approach necessitates robust mechanisms for identity verification, transaction monitoring, and reporting, all operating within a decentralized environment. Effective implementation requires collaboration between regulators, technology developers, and market participants to establish clear standards and protocols.

## What is the Algorithm of Decentralized Regulatory Compliance?

⎊ The core of Decentralized Regulatory Compliance is driven by algorithms designed to interpret and enforce regulatory rules automatically. These algorithms, often implemented as smart contracts, analyze transaction data against predefined criteria, triggering actions such as flagging suspicious activity or restricting fund transfers. Sophisticated algorithms incorporate machine learning to adapt to evolving regulatory landscapes and detect novel forms of illicit activity. The precision and efficiency of these algorithms are paramount, demanding rigorous testing and validation to minimize false positives and ensure equitable enforcement.
